GetDevelop: Cloud Apps für die Unternehmenstransformation

Suraj Raghunath

Globaler Portfolio Partner

In diesem Artikel:

In den kommenden Jahren werden sich Cloud-Anwendungen für die überwiegende Mehrheit der digitalen Arbeitslasten als unverzichtbar erweisen. Die richtige Entwicklung dieser Anwendungen wird daher entscheidend für den Unternehmenserfolg sein - unabhängig davon, ob sie von älteren Tools übernommen oder als Teil eines Cloud-nativen Ansatzes von Grund auf neu entwickelt werden.

Laut Gartner wird die Cloud das "Herzstück neuer digitaler Erfahrungen" bilden, wobei der weltweite Cloud-Umsatz in diesem Jahr voraussichtlich 474 Milliarden Dollar erreichen wird. Ob kleine Unternehmen oder multinationale Konzerne - Cloud Computing revolutioniert eine Vielzahl von Prozessen, von der Kommunikation bis zur Personalverwaltung.

Unternehmen verschiedener Branchen erkennen die Vorteile der digitalen Transformation - und die Rolle, die Cloud-Anwendungen auf diesem Weg spielen können. Cloud-Geschäftsanwendungen haben den Übergang von beliebt zu omnipräsent geschafft - aufgrund der vielen Vorteile, die sie bieten, einschließlich der hier dargestellten.

Cloud-Anwendungen können viele Vorteile in Bezug auf Wirtschaftlichkeit, Skalierbarkeit und Zuverlässigkeit bieten. Cloud-Migration und App-Modernisierung bedeuten, dass Unternehmen ihre schwerfälligen, veralteten Lösungen zugunsten von flexibleren Cloud-Diensten ablösen können. SaaS-Anwendungen werden mittlerweile 99 % der Unternehmen genutzt, um Defizite oder ihre derzeitigen Aktivitäten zu optimieren. Einfach gesagt, ist eine Kombination der oben genannten Punkte ist für jedes Unternehmen unerlässlich.

Obwohl viele Unternehmen Cloud-Anwendungen nutzen, gibt es immer noch Organisationen, die ihr Potenzial noch nicht voll ausschöpfen. Schätzungen zufolge werden bis 2025 mehr als 85 % der Unternehmen einen Cloud-first-Ansatz verfolgen und ihre digitalen Strategien ohne den Einsatz von Cloud-nativen Architekturen und Technologien nicht vollständig umsetzen können.

Die Art der App-Transformation und Softwareentwicklung, die erforderlich ist, um sicherzustellen, dass Ihre Cloud-Lösungen optimale Leistung erbringen, kann jedoch eine Herausforderung sein. Deshalb haben wir bei Getronics ein Framework entwickelt, das den Weg einer App in die Cloud bzw. innerhalb der Cloud vereinfacht. Mit seinen vier Schwerpunktbereichen ist GetDevelop unser branchenführendes Programm zur Entwicklung von Cloud-Apps - und es könnte die Vorteile von Cloud-Apps für Ihr Unternehmen erschließen.

Nahtlose Cloud-Migration oder Cloud-first-Anwendungen?

Auch wenn die Gründe für die Nutzung von Cloud-Anwendungen klar sind, ist die Frage, wie Unternehmen sie einsetzen sollten, nicht ganz so einfach zu beantworten. Obwohl sich Cloud-native Anwendungen immer größerer Beliebtheit erfreuen, entscheiden sich viele Unternehmen stattdessen für die Migration ihrer bestehenden On-Premise-Software - vor allem dann, wenn es sich um bewährte und zuverlässige Altanwendungen handelt. Mit den richtigen Cloud-Migrationsspezialisten kann dieser Ansatz zur Erschließung neuer Möglichkeiten führen.

Die oben erwähnten Gartner-Ergebnisse zeigen, dass im vergangenen Jahr nur 30 % der digitalen Arbeitslasten auf Cloud-nativen Plattformen bereitgestellt wurden. Diese Zahl steigt zwar weiter an, bedeutet aber auch, dass knapp drei Viertel der Entscheider noch nicht bereit sind, alle ihre Workloads auf Cloud-native Lösungen umzustellen. Jedes Framework für die erfolgreiche Entwicklung von Cloud-Apps muss daher die anhaltende Rolle von älteren Anwendungen und ihre Migration berücksichtigen.

Wie Sie mit Cloud-Anwendungen erfolgreich sein können

Bei GetDevelop wissen wir, dass der Weg in die Cloud je nach spezifisch genutzter Anwendung, unterschiedlich ist. Deshalb hat unser Framework für die Entwicklung von Cloud-Apps vier verschiedene Schwerpunktbereiche, die auf eine Vielzahl von Geschäftsanforderungen zugeschnitten sind:

1. App-Transformation als Teil der Reise in die Cloud

Es mag zwar zutreffen, dass eine die Transformation von älteren Anwendungen für Unternehmen einen Wettbewerbsnachteil bedeuten kann, aber es ist ebenso wichtig zu erkennen, dass es keine Einheitslösung gibt. Jedes Unternehmen und jede Anwendung hat eine eigene Historie und erfordert einen maßgeschneiderten Ansatz.

Wenn Sie sich auf die Transformation von Anwendungen konzentrieren, bevor Sie in die Cloud migrieren, können Sie ein hohes Maß an Unternehmenswachstum und Agilität mit minimalen Unterbrechungen erreichen. In einigen Fällen kann es möglich sein, einen "Lift-and-Shift"-Ansatz zu verfolgen, in anderen Fällen kann eine teilweise (oder umfassende) Überarbeitung oder Umstrukturierung erforderlich sein. In jedem Fall müssen Unternehmen das Rad nicht neu erfinden, um das Beste aus ihren bestehenden Anwendungen in einer Cloud-Umgebung herauszuholen.

2. App-Transformation direkt in der Cloud

Bei der Modernisierung von Anwendungen in der Cloud ist Geschäftskontinuität von zentraler Bedeutung. Dazu gehören die sorgfältige Bewertung Ihrer bestehenden Anwendung, die iterative Umstrukturierung der Anwendung und die Umstellung des Codes einer Anwendung, ohne ihre Funktion wesentlich zu verändern. Bei diesem Ansatz geht es auch darum, die künftige Bedienbarkeit der Anwendung zu vereinfachen.

Die Cloud ist kein Ziel, sondern eine Reise. Das bedeutet, dass die Umwandlung von Anwendungen ähnlich flexibel sein muss, um sich wechselnden Anforderungen anzupassen. Bei diesem Ansatz geht es jedoch nicht um eine Transformation um ihrer selbst willen. Bei der App-Transformation in der Cloud geht es darum, ein Redesign zu implementieren, das den Wert der Transformation maximiert, aber schrittweise Änderungen durchführt.

3. SaaS-Implementierung und -Integration

Mit dem dritten Schwerpunktbereich von GetDevelop sichern wir den Erfolg Ihrer App, und führen gleichzeitig neue SaaS-Angebote in Ihr bestehendes Geschäft ein. Dies erfordert von Unternehmen eine intelligente Einteilung und Budgetierung des mit der Implementierung und Integration verbundenen Aufwands.

Mit GetDevelop prüfen wir die Optionen für die Ablösung und den Ersatz bestehender Anwendungen sowie den Bedarf an Integration (falls erforderlich). Wir evaluieren SaaS-Alternativen, die die Funktionalität erhöhen, Skalierbarkeit und Agilität bieten und gleichzeitig kosteneffizient sind, und erstellen eine Auswahlliste. Und wir implementieren strenge KPIs und SLA-Maßnahmen mit Ihrem SaaS-Anbieter.

4. Cloud-native App-Entwicklung

Bei der Cloud-nativen App-Entwicklung können sich Unternehmen entweder für eine freie Entwicklung oder die "R"-Strategie (Rehost, Rearchitect, Refactor, Rebuild) entscheiden. In beiden Fällen erstellt Getronics die Anwendung mit Cloud-Native-Fähigkeit. Die Entwicklung kann sowohl auf privaten PaaS als auch direkt auf den Cloud-Plattformen Azure und AWS erfolgen.

GetDevelop nimmt Anforderungen aus verschiedenen Geschäftsbereichen auf und kombiniert sie mit Best Practices aus einer Vielzahl von Branchen. So kann GetDevelop Apps mit einem responsiven Look and Feel entwerfen. Basierend auf dem nötigen technischen Know-how und innerhalb eines agilen Entwicklungszyklus.

Maximierung des ROI durch den Einsatz von Cloud-nativen Lösungen

GetDevelop ist unser Ansatz für die Entwicklung von Softwareanwendungen, die die Vorteile des Cloud-Computing voll ausschöpfen. In der Praxis bedeutet dies, dass wir Anwendungen entwickeln, die den Bedürfnissen unserer Kunden entsprechen - unabhängig davon, ob sie es vorziehen, bestehende Anwendungen zu migrieren oder Cloud-first-Lösungen von Grund auf neu zu entwickeln.

Sicherlich bieten Cloud-Apps mehrere Vorteile gegenüber älteren Tools. Sie ermöglichen eine schnellere, zuverlässigere und skalierbarere Softwareentwicklung, indem sie die Markteinführungszeit und die Kosten drastisch reduzieren. Gleichzeitig ermöglicht unser GetDevelop-Angebot den Unternehmen aber auch die Transformation bestehender Anwendungen durch seine Rearchitektur- und Refactoring-Services. GetDevelop erreicht dies, indem es die flexible Infrastruktur von Cloud-Services mit deren Automatisierungs- und Orchestrierungsvorteilen nutzt, um eine wirklich agile Bereitstellung in verschiedenen vertikalen Bereichen zu ermöglichen. All dies wird durch unsere Teams von Cloud-Spezialisten auf der ganzen Welt ermöglicht.

Wie alle unsere anderen Services ist GetDevelop neben GetConsult, GetMigrate, GetManage und GetTransform vollständig in das Getronics Cloud Framework integriert.

Mit unserem GetDevelop-Service können wir Sie bei der Entwicklung einer Cloud-Anwendung unterstützen, die den Unternehmensumsatz maximiert und in die bestehende IT-Umgebung eines Unternehmens passt. Finden Sie heraus, wie das Team der Cloud-Spezialisten von Getronics Sie bei der Entwicklung von Cloud-Anwendungen unterstützen kann, die speziell auf Ihre Bedürfnisse zugeschnitten sind - sowohl jetzt als auch in Zukunft.